The Mechanics of Finding the Median on a Graph
So, how do you find the median on a graph? The process is relatively straightforward and can be broken down into a few simple steps. First, the dataset must be arranged in ascending or descending order. Next, the middle value is identified, which represents the median. If the dataset contains an even number of values, the median is the average of the two middle values.

Common Curiosities and Misconceptions
One common misconception about finding the median is that it is always the middle value in a dataset. However, this is not always the case. If the dataset contains an even number of values, the median is the average of the two middle values. Additionally, some users may be curious about how to find the median when the dataset contains outliers or missing values. In such cases, the median is often a more robust estimator than the mean, as it is less affected by extreme values.
